The Big Ideas Project, launched in December 2014 by the Progressive Change Institute, is a crowd-sourced platform allowing the public, leading policy experts, progressive organizations, celebrities and others to submit and vote on big ideas they believe progressives should champion in 2015 and 2016.

Voting ended on Friday, January 16 at noon Eastern. 30 members of Congress have committed to taking a serious look at the 20 big ideas that rose to the top.
